About this spot
A shrine long cherished by locals as the guardian shrine of Iwatsuki, with a long approach path covered by dense trees being its greatest attraction. As you walk along the approach path deeper into the shrine, you'll feel the air becoming clearer, and even on hot summer days, the tree shade brings coolness. There is a pond within the grounds, creating a peaceful spot for a quiet moment. Even on the fireworks festival day, it remains relatively uncrowded and allows for leisurely worship.

Tips
About 20 minutes on foot from the Iwatsuki Station shopping street; bus service is also convenient. The approach path is long, so wear comfortable shoes. Entry is free, and Iwatsuki Castle Ruins Park is also within walking distance.
Best time to visit
Approximately 45 minutes required. The shaded approach path is easy to walk even on hot summer days
